u/Confident-Giraffe-24 Apr 07 '24

I came to say something similar.

It is way too easy to see patterns that aren't really there or valid, you see it because you want to.

One of my rules is literally "no trading patterns".

Supply and demand, support and resistance, these things are more difficult to make up.

u/Front_Maintenance_41 Apr 07 '24

I've lost enough money trying to time breaks of structure , which is usually what people are trying to do when they trade patterns IMO.

I'm also "only suppose to trade the current price range", whether that be a small range, or the daily range.

Most breakouts fail, so wouldn't it make a ton more sense to just place your trades within the range that price is currently moving in.
